Types of Bets Available
Within the legal framework of Saskatchewan’s sports betting landscape, bettors can explore several types of wagers:
- Parlay Bets: Popular among bettors, this involves wagering on multiple outcomes. All selections must win for the bet to be successful.
- Prop Bets: These bets focus on individual player performances or specific events during a game, rather than the overall game outcome.
- Point Spread Bets: This method involves betting on the margin of victory within a game, focusing on how much one team is favored to win over another.
- Over/Under Bets: Also known as totals, this type of bet focuses on the cumulative score of both teams in a game, deciding whether it will be over or under a specified figure.
Each type of bet offers unique strategies and thrills for bettors, allowing for a personalized betting experience.

Strategies for Successful Sports Betting
Success in sports betting requires more than just luck; it involves a combination of strategy, research, and emotional control. Adapting specific strategies can greatly enhance a bettor’s chances of success.
Basic Strategies for Beginners
For those new to sports betting, starting with a few fundamental strategies is vital:
- Bankroll Management: Set aside a specific amount for betting and stick to it. Never bet more than you can afford to lose.
- Research: Before placing any bets, research teams, players, and statistics. Knowledge is power in making informed decisions.
- Focus on One Sport: Initially, concentrate on a single sport to develop expertise before branching out to others.
Using these strategies allows beginners to establish a solid foundation in sports betting.
Advanced Betting Techniques
As bettors gain experience, they might want to explore advanced techniques, such as:
- Value Betting: Identify bets that offer higher value than their probability suggests, thus increasing potential profits.
- Line Shopping: Always compare odds across multiple sportsbooks to find the best available lines.
- Statistical Analysis: Use data and statistics to inform betting decisions, focusing on trends and patterns.
Employing these advanced techniques can elevate a bettor’s strategy significantly.
